The US Secretary of Defense was in the hospital suffering from prostate cancer
Lloyd Austin had to be treated in the intensive care unit, US President Joe Biden knew nothing about this, and the White House reacted angrily accordingly.
US Secretary of Defense Lloyd Austin revealed that he has been diagnosed with prostate cancer. The disease was identified early and the prognosis for recovery was “excellent,” as the responsible clinic near Washington, D.C., announced on Tuesday. Due to complications after the procedure at the end of December The 70-year-old man has had to receive treatment in hospital since the beginning of the year.
The clinic said prostate cancer was diagnosed at the beginning of December. Shortly before Christmas, Austin underwent minimally invasive surgery. A statement issued by Walter Reed Military Hospital in Bethesda said that the minister “recovered from the operation without any problems and returned home the next morning.”
On New Year's Day, the Defense Minister was taken to hospital due to complications, including nausea and severe stomach, hip and leg pain. Initial examination revealed a urinary tract infection. On January 2, he was transferred to the intensive care unit. According to the clinic, fluid accumulation in the abdominal cavity causes problems.
The infection has now subsided. Austin is making progress and a “full recovery” is expected, but this could be a long process. “During this stay, Secretary Austin never lost consciousness and was never under general anesthesia,” the clinic said.
Information policy under attack
The Pentagon has been criticized for its media policy. Not only was she informed of the hospital stay very late, she also refrained from providing details. The Pentagon initially did not provide any information about what type of procedure caused complications and what treatment was necessary.
It is common practice in the United States for the public to be very closely informed about the health of senior politicians. The fact that the Defense Minister in particular spent several days in hospital unnoticed due to the situation in the Middle East was met with great incomprehension. When asked, a Pentagon spokesman admitted that the White House was not aware of the original intervention.
The White House is also upset
According to the White House, Biden did not learn that his Secretary of Defense had been diagnosed with prostate cancer until Tuesday morning. “No one in the White House knew that Secretary Austin had prostate cancer until this morning,” John Kirby, communications director for the National Security Council, said Tuesday. This means that Biden found out about Austin's illness a few hours before the audience. Kirby explained that Biden wishes the 70-year-old a speedy recovery. Asked if Biden intends to keep Austin until the end of his term early next year, Kirby said: “Yes.”
At the same time, the White House was clearly critical of Austin's media policy. “This is not the way it's supposed to happen,” Kirby said. This is why Biden wants to reconsider the procedures for such cases in the government. Kirby said it's important to make sure something like this doesn't happen again. As a member of the Cabinet, everyone knows that this comes with a commitment to being as transparent as possible.
